New technique

Super easy to do I didn't do any leaf tucking or training I just cut it a certain way at the beginning ..I think this way would be good for people in smaller tents like 2 x 2 which keeps it lower but nice even canopy. Picture below on how it would look once you got 3 nodes you just cut off the big fan leaves at the top to expose the lower branches so it slows the top down allowing the other branches to catch up creating a nice canopy. No topping just fan leaves
